Transaction 33a8e8ea27c29999ae586d55f199be042348fe18dea2d7a4a0d7648daa6f3599
1 Input
1 Output
-
33a8e8ea27c29999ae586d55f199be042348fe18dea2d7a4a0d7648daa6f3599:0
- value
- 26678
- script pubkey
- OP_0 OP_PUSHBYTES_20 64157a4aa0840e5799b911e0cf167a75c39c0b54
- address
- bc1qvs2h5j4qss890xdez8sv79n6whpecz65eskk3g